Transaction 17687841cce246967b0a4134a068c50af066cc2f7c5e2f1cdd4718393ece9faa
1 Input
1 Output
-
17687841cce246967b0a4134a068c50af066cc2f7c5e2f1cdd4718393ece9faa:0
- value
- 4245718
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2e783b6dae83b99ebf4d6fa6f0580096c471330 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LEAFCHCgLD5no658UTWKETZWtLf5WM3Ws